Pots are one of the oldest human inventions. They have been used for various purposes since the Neolithic period. The use of pots has evolved over time, but their primary function has always been cooking food.
History of Pots:
The history of pots dates back to the Neolithic period when humans started to settle in one place and began farming. They needed a container to cook food and store water. The first pots were made of clay and were hand-built. Later, people started using the potter's wheel to make pots.
Uses of Pots:
Pots have been used for various purposes throughout history. Some of the uses of pots are:
- Cooking food: As mentioned earlier, cooking food is the primary function of pots. Pots are used to cook food by heating them over a fire or stove.
- Storing food: Pots are also used to store food. In ancient times, people used to preserve the flesh of animals in pots.
- Transporting water: Pots are also used to transport water. In some parts of the world, people still carry water in pots on their heads.
- Religious ceremonies: Pots are also used in religious ceremonies. In Hinduism, pots filled with water are used in certain rituals.
